### Introduction

1. This application seeks permission for the additional use of a residential flat as a self catering tourist accommodation in an area zoned as Mixed Use. The application is considered to be acceptable and is in accordance with the relevant policies of the Isle of Man Strategic Plan.

### The Site

2. The application site is the curtilage of 2 Bridge Street, Peel which is a three storey property situated on the corner of Bridge Street and Christian Street. The ground floor is in commercial use and the first and second floors are currently used as residential accommodation.

### The Proposal

3. The application seeks approval to use the existing flat as self catering tourist accommodation in addition to the existing rental. No external works are proposed as part of this application.

### Development Plan Policies

5. The application site is in an area zoned as "Mixed Use" identified on the Peel Local Plan 1989. It is appropriate to consider General Policy 2 and Business Policy 13 of the Isle of Man Strategic Plan (20th June 2007).

6. General Policy 2

Development which is in accordance with the land-use zoning and proposals in the appropriate Area Plan and with other policies of this Strategic Plan will normally be permitted, provided that the development:

a) Is in accordance with the design brief in the Area Plan where there is such a brief; b) Respects the site and surroundings in terms of the siting, layout, scale, form, design and landscaping of buildings and the spaces around them; c) Does not affect adversely the character of the surrounding landscape or townscape; d) Does not adversely affect the protected wildlife or locally important habitats on the site or adjacent land, including water courses;

e) Does not affect adversely public views of the sea; f) Incorporates where possible existing topography and landscape features, particularly trees and sod banks; g) Does not affect adversely the amenity of local residents or the character of the locality; h) Provides satisfactory amenity standards in itself, including where appropriate safe and convenient access for all highway users, together with adequate parking, servicing and manoeuvring space; i) Does not have an unacceptable effect on road safety or traffic flows on the local highways; j) Can be provided with all necessary services; k) Does not prejudice the use or development of adjoining land in accordance with the appropriate Area Plan; l) Is not on contaminated land or subject to unreasonable risk of erosion or flooding; m) Takes account of community and personal safety and security in the design of buildings and the spaces around them; and n) Is designed having due regard to best practice in reducing energy consumption.

7. Business Policy 13
Permission will generally be given for the use of private residential properties as tourist accommodation providing that it can be demonstrated that such use would not compromise the amenities of neighbouring residents.

### Consultations

8. Highways Division recommend approval as it has no adverse traffic management, parking or road safety implications.
9. Peel Commissioners recommend approval.

### Assessment

10. The application site is in an area of mixed use, therefore the principle of the development is considered to be acceptable.
11. Business Policy 13 supports the use of private residential properties as tourist accommodation provided that the proposal would not affect the amenities of local residents.
12. The ground floor is currently used for commercial purposes and there are a number of residential properties in the vicinity of the application site.
13. It is considered that the additional use of the flat for tourist accommodation would not unduly impact the amenities of local residents.
14. For the above reasons the application is considered to be acceptable and is recommended for approval.

### Party Status

15. The local authority, Peel Commissioners is, by virtue of the Town and Country Planning (Development Procedure) Order 2005, paragraph 6 (5) (d), considered an "interested person" and as such should be afforded party status.
16. The Department of Transport Highways and Traffic Division is now part of the Department of Infrastructure of which the planning authority is part. As such, the Highways and Traffic Division cannot be afforded party status in this instance.
